High Protein Chicken Dinner: Greek Chicken Souvlaki with Tzatziki Recipe

Marinated chicken, cool tzatziki, maybe some pita on the side. This Greek classic is a high protein chicken dinner that tastes like a Mediterranean vacation.

Cook 45 min Difficulty NORMAL 340 kcal
#high protein #mediterranean #DASH
Image coming soon
Ingredients
Main ingredients
  • boneless skinless chicken breast 1.5 lbs
  • plain Greek yogurt 1 cup
  • English cucumber 0.5 cup
  • lemon 1 piece
  • garlic cloves 3 cloves
  • red onion 0.5 cup
  • pita bread 4 pieces
Seasonings/Sauce
  • olive oil 3 tbsp
  • dried oregano 2 tsp
  • salt 1 tsp
  • black pepper 0.5 tsp
  • fresh dill 1 tbsp
Nutrition summary
Carbohydrates 22 g 26%
Protein 31 g 36%
Fat 12 g 32%
Serving size 220g
Cooking steps
  1. 1

    Trim and cut the chicken breast into 1-inch cubes, then set aside in a large bowl.

  2. 2

    In a separate bowl, combine olive oil, juice and zest from the lemon, minced garlic, dried oregano, salt, and black pepper. Pour this marinade over the chicken and toss thoroughly. Cover and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es (up to 2 hours) for more flavor.

  3. 3

    For the tzatziki, grate the cucumber and squeeze out excess moisture. Mix with Greek yogurt, minced garlic, lemon juice, and chopped fresh dill. Season with salt and pepper, then chill.

  4. 4

    Thread marinated chicken pieces onto skewers. Preheat grill or grill pan to medium-high heat. Grill chicken skewers for 4–5 minutes per side, turning once, until they have clear grill marks and reach 165°F internal temperature.

  5. 5

    Warm pita bread slices briefly on the grill. Serve chicken skewers on a plate with a generous spoonful of tzatziki, sliced red onion, and pita bread on the side.

Personalized Q&A
Q. What's the key ingredient in this recipe?
The heart of this recipe is boneless, skinless chicken breast, which provides a lean texture and high protein content. The marinade, featuring olive oil, lemon, garlic, and oregano, is essential in giving the souvlaki its authentic Greek flavor.
Q. Which step is most important for juicy chicken?
Marinating the chicken for at least 30 minutes in the seasoned olive oil and lemon mixture is crucial. This step not only tenderizes the meat but also infuses it with Greek flavors, ensuring the chicken stays moist when grilled over medium-high heat.
Q. How do I prevent dry or tough chicken in this recipe?
Avoid overcooking the chicken. Grill over medium-high heat and turn skewers once, cooking for 4–5 minutes per side. Check that the internal temperature reaches 165°F, then remove promptly. Also, cutting the chicken into uniform cubes helps with even cooking.
